πŸ“‹ Key Responsibilities

βœ… Leads a team of professionals who partner with leaders of the product and distribution channels to advise, influence, and drive strategy within the various business lines

βœ… Balances risk mitigation for LOBs across all financial crimes disciplines (Insider, Fraud, and KYC) while enabling business growth

βœ… Ensures the program continually evolves to meet the needs of the business and proactively protect customers

βœ… Provides people management leadership by hiring the best talent, setting goals, developing staff, managing employee performance, and compensation decisions

βœ… Leads the interaction model for all Account Originations partners, including support and oversight functions

βœ… Serves as a conduit to deliver strategies to business partners from Financial Crimes Management

βœ… Drives engagement in Strategic Initiatives process, including New Business Product Assessment (NBPA) process

βœ… Drives engagement and prioritization discussions with business partners, as well as supports engagement with FCM Strategic Initiatives

βœ… Participates in the review of New Business Product Assessment (NBPA) process and partners with Risk Management for challenge discussions

βœ… Advises and influences partners on all matters, strategizes with them on establishment of key priorities and customer experience targets

βœ… Drives strategic discussions on matters of impact related to Account Originations partners and where Board and regulatory updates

βœ… Creates proper balance between Prevention / Detection and Customer Experience

βœ… Translates balance into actionable strategies to maximize Financial Crimes Protection, while minimizing Customer interruptions

βœ… Works with Product and Channels leads to establish proper KPIs and KRIs, and thresholds associated with them, to manage Customer Experience within our Risk Appetite

βœ… Supports Work Initiation process for Account Originations specific work to evaluate and size new Partner requested projects

βœ… Establishes Contribute to the Customer Experience strategy and roadmap for key processes (i.e., Detection and Claims)

βœ… Establishes Operating Strategies focused on optimizing capabilities within internal and external operational teams

βœ… Acts as the conduit to internal fraud teams to share performance metrics, incidents, and initiatives

βœ… Drives strategic engagement with FCM and business partners to provide insights on vulnerabilities identified and proposed mitigation strategies

βœ… Provides insights on industry trends, innovation, and capabilities to drive best in class solutions for our businesses, colleagues, and customers

🎯 Required Qualifications

Education: Bachelor's degree preferred

Experience: 10+ years' experience in Financial Crimes Strategy, Analytics, and/or Operations with a proven track record for leading strategic aspects of Financial Crimes Management

Required Skills:

  • Proven leadership skills and the ability to manage complex problems
  • Strong analytical abilities that enable complex problems to be broken down into simple understandable components
  • Strong organizational skills, with the ability to work in a fast-paced environment and manage multiple deadlines and priorities
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, both written and verbal
  • Strong people leader with demonstrated experience in identifying and growing talent
  • Demonstrated experience in leading change and making an impact in cross-functional groups, through influence and strong relationships

Preferred Skills:

  • Experience in leading teams with significant expense and/or loss plan oversight
  • Experience in leading transformational change and developing a business strategy and leading that strategy through successful implementation
  • Experience in leading material process change within and outside of the LOB
